DOCKETS ON TWO RAIL INVESTIGATIONS ************************************************************ The National
Transportation Safety Board today opened public dockets on two on-going
railroad accident investigations and placed the
dockets on its public website. The accident
dockets opened today are: July 5, 2009,
Lake Buena Vista, Florida. A train operator was killed when
two monorail passenger trains collided at Walt Disney World
Theme Park. July 18, 2009,
San Francisco, California. A collision occurred between
two MUNI light rail vehicles at the West Portal Station,
injuring 48 people. The dockets can

link to "Railroad." The dockets
contain factual information developed by investigators.
There is no determination of cause; that will occur at a
later date. This is a document release only. No interviews
will be conducted by the NTSB. - 30 - NTSB Media
